Thursday, January 2, 2014

About Cisco Router Boot Sequence



Cisco ပိုင္းကို ေလ့လာေနတဲ့ သူေတြအတြက္ ကၽြန္ေတာ္သိ့သေလာက္ နည္းနည္း မွ်ေ၀ ေပးတာပါ။ ဆရာေတြကေတာ့ ဒီ post ကိုေက်ာ္ဖတ္သြားလိုက္ပါ။ Router တစ္လုံးကို Power ဖြင့္လိုက္ရင္ အဲဒီ Router က ဘယ္လို စၿပီး အလုပ္လုပ္သလဲ ??? Cisco အဆင့္ထိေရာက္ၿပီဆိုေတာ့ အေျခခံ Computer Hardware ေလာက္ေတာ့ ကၽြမ္းက်င္မွာပါေနာ္။ အဲဒါဆို Computer တစ္လုံးကို Power ခလုတ္ဖြင့္လိုက္ရင္ေရာ ဘယ္လို အလုပ္လုပ္လဲ ??? တစ္ကယ္ေတာ့ router က computer ရဲ႕ boot sequence နဲ႔ သေဘာတရားခ်င္း အတူတူပါပဲ။ Hardware ေတြသာ ကြာျခားသြားတာပါ။ ကၽြန္ေတာ္ေအာက္မွာ ေရးျပတာေလးကို computerနဲ႔ တူလားလို႔ ခင္ဗ်ားတို႔ စဥ္းစားၾကည့္လိုက္ေပါ့ ..... ???
Computer မွာ CPU ပါတယ္။ Router မွာလဲ CPU ပါပါတယ္။

Computer မွာ RAM ပါတယ္။ Router မွာလဲ RAM ပါပါတယ္။

Computer မွာ OS န႔ဲ Data သိမ္းဖို႔အတြက္ HDD ပါတယ္။ Router မွာလဲ IOS သိမ္းဖို႔အတြက္ Flash Memory ပါပါတယ္။

Computer မွာ ROM ဆိုတဲ့ Program ပါတယ္။ Router မွာလဲ ROM ဆိုတဲ့ Program ပါတာပါပဲ။

စဥ္းစားလို႔ရေအာင္ လမ္းေၾကာင္းေပးၾကည့္တာပါ။ .... က်န္တာေတာ့ ကိုယ့္ဘာသာကိုယ္ ျဖည့္ၿပီး စဥ္းစားၾကည့္လုိက္ေပါ့။ computer ROM ထဲက ဘာေတြ ပါလဲ ဘာေတြ လုပ္လဲ ။ router ROM ထဲကေရာ ဘာေတြ ပါလဲ ။ ဘာေတြ လုပ္လဲ ။ 


Router Boot Sequence




 
၁။ ပထမဆုံးအေနနဲ႔ Router ကို Power ဖြင့္လိုက္ရင္ POST ဆိုတဲ့ Power-On Self Test ဆိုတဲ့ လုပ္ငန္းႀကီး စလုပ္ပါတယ္။ ကြန္ပ်ဴတာမွာေရာ အဲလိုပဲထင္တယ္ ။ ကၽြန္ေတာ္ေတာ့ ေသခ်ာမသိ့ဘူး။ အဲဒီ POST က Router ထဲမွာ ပါ၀င္တဲ့ Hardware Components ေတြ ေကာင္းမြန္စြာ အလုပ္လုပ္ရဲ႕လား ဆိုတာကို ပထမ စစ္ေဆးေပးပါတယ္။ ေနာက္တစ္ခု Router ရဲ႕ Different Interfaces မ်ားကိုလဲ စစ္ေဆးေပးပါတယ္။ POST က Router မွာေတာ့ ROM ထဲမွာေနတယ္။ Computer မွာေရာ ဘယ္ထဲမွာ ေနလဲဗ် ???


၂။ ဒုတိယ အေနနဲ႔ေတာ့ Cisco IOS ကိုရွာေဖြဖို႔နဲ႔ Load လုပ္ဖို႔အတြက္ Bootstrap ဆိုတ့ဲ program ေလးက လုပ္ေဆာင္ေပးပါတယ္။ အဲဒီ Program ေလးလဲ ROM ထဲမွာ ေနပါတယ္။ Cisco IOS ဆိုတာကေတာ့ Flash Memory ထဲမွာရိွပါတယ္။ Cisco IOS ကိုစစ္ေဆးဖို႔နဲ႔ သူ႔ရဲ႕ version ကိုၾကည့္ဖို႔အတြက္ကေတာ့ router ရဲ႕ Privileged Mode မွာ show flash ဆိုတဲ့ command ကိုသုံးၿပီး ၾကည့္ႏိုင္ပါတယ္။ Computer မွာေရာ Operating System တက္ဖို႔အတြက္ Boot File ကိုရွာတယ္ထင္တယ္ေနာ္ ။


၃။ တတိယ အေနနဲ႔ Configuration File ကိုရွာေဖြေပးပါတယ္။ Cisco IOS ကို Load လုပ္ၿပီးတဲ့ အခါ NVRAM ထဲမွာ Configuration File ကို သြားရွာေပးပါတယ္။ Configuration File ဆိုတာေတာ့ ရွင္းပါတယ္။ ကၽြန္ေတာ္တို႔ configure လုပ္ထားတဲ့ Name , IP , Setting ဘာညာေတြေပါ့။ 


၄။ ဒီတစ္ခါေတာ့ Startup-config File က NVRAM မွာရိွေနခဲ့တယ္ဆိုရင္ Router က RAM ေပၚသို႔ Copy ကူးၿပီး ပို႔ေဆာင္ေပးလိုက္ပါတယ္။ အဲဒီအခ်ိန္မွာေတာ့ config file ေတြက ကၽြန္ေတာ္တို႔ RAM ေပၚမွာ Running-Config File အေနနဲ႔ ေရာက္သြားပါတယ္။ running config ဆိုတာ မသိမ္းရေသးတာေပါ့။ Save လုပ္လိုက္မွ Startup config လို႔ေခၚတာပါ။ Router ရဲ႕ boot sequenceက ဒီေလာက္ပါပဲ။ 


လိုအပ္ခ်က္ေတြကို နားလည္ေပးၾကမယ္လို႔ ေမွ်ာ္လင့္ပါတယ္။ Network ပိုင္းက အြန္လိုင္းေပၚမွာ ဆရာေတြ မ်ားတယ္ေလ။ ကၽြန္ေတာ္က အမႈန္တစ္မႈန္စာပဲ ရိွတာပါ ။ အခုေရးတယ္ဆိုတာလဲ ေခါင္းထဲေပၚတာေတြ ခ်ေရးလိုက္တာ လိုအပ္ခ်က္ေတြ ရိွေနမွာ ေသခ်ာတယ္။


No comments:

Post a Comment